>>> I continue to think this an unfortunate campaign.  Putting aside the 
>>> real question of the effect of the war on the American economy, it is 
>>> at best a matter of preaching to the converted: you find this argument 
>>> effective if and only if you already find something wrong with the war.
>>>
>>> Consider what the reaction would be to such a campaign in the US 
>>> during the Second World War.  If you said the fight against Naziism 
>>> was costing too much, you would be condemned as someone putting a 
>>> price on freedom.
>>>
>>> We have to be imaginative enough to realize that defenders of the 
>>> current war hold a similar opinion.  If we can't convince them that 
>>> they're wrong about the character of the war, we won't convince them 
>>> with niggling complaints about the cost. --CGE
